efi_loader: parameter checks in StartImage and Exit()
authorHeinrich Schuchardt <xypron.glpk@gmx.de>
Tue, 26 Mar 2019 18:03:17 +0000 (19:03 +0100)
committerHeinrich Schuchardt <xypron.glpk@gmx.de>
Sun, 7 Apr 2019 12:17:06 +0000 (14:17 +0200)
Add parameter checks in the StartImage() and Exit() boottime services:
- check that the image handle is valid and has the loaded image protocol
  installed
- in StartImage() record the current image
- in Exit() check that the image is the current image
